The West Wing Season 1 introduces viewers to the fast-paced world of the White House under the leadership of President Josiah "Jed" Bartlet (Martin Sheen). Rather than focusing on political scandals alone, the series explores the daily challenges of governing a nation through intelligent dialogue, ethical dilemmas, and personal relationships. From handling international crises to passing legislation, every episode reveals the pressure behind the Oval Office doors. The season follows key members of the administration, including Leo McGarry, the trusted Chief of Staff; Josh Lyman, the ambitious Deputy Chief of Staff; Sam Seaborn, an idealistic Deputy Communications Director; Toby Ziegler, the brilliant but blunt Communications Director; C.J. Cregg, the confident White House Press Secretary; Charlie Young, President Bartlet's loyal personal aide; and Donna Moss, Josh's quick-witted assistant. Together, they navigate political negotiations, media scrutiny, national emergencies, and personal sacrifices while striving to serve the American people.

Season 1 changed the way television portrayed politics by focusing on intelligent conversations rather than action. Aaron Sorkin’s sharp writing and Thomas Schlamme’s signature “walk-and-talk” camera style became iconic, influencing countless television dramas that followed. The show won widespread critical acclaim during its debut season and quickly developed a reputation for combining idealism with realistic political challenges.

Did You Know

One of the most fascinating facts about Season 1 is that President Bartlet was originally intended to appear only occasionally, with the main focus on his senior staff. However, Martin Sheen’s powerful performance impressed the creators so much that his role was significantly expanded, transforming Bartlet into the heart of the series.
